A Far North Queensland woman is jailed for more than nine years for sex offences against her own son and three nephews which left the boys sad, suicidal and angry.

The youngest boy, who was twice raped, was threatened that he would be exposed on Facebook if the matter became public.

In harrowing victim impact statements read to the court, the nephews' mothers said they had witnessed their worst fears realised as their children rapidly and inexplicably deteriorated into people they no longer recognised. "He is now a sad, suicidal and angry child who does not trust adults, except those who have proven themselves safe in his eyes."You are the worst kind of predator — the predator we invited over for sleepovers and for Christmas Day; the monster who bought my kids treats and invited them to stay over at your house."
